Large size, tenant & infra mix needed for success of malls: DLF
NEW DELHI: Large shopping malls with right mix of tenants and good infrastructure would have a greater chance of success going forward, a top official of realty major DLF said today.

"Going forward, game changer will be size of the shopping malls. Sizes are becoming an important factor," DLF Managing Director (Rental Business) Ramesh Sanka said at a conference.

The size of shopping malls, except those which caters only to luxury retail, should be at least a million sq ft, he added.

"Brand makes the mall a success. Customers want right mix of tenants," Sanka said, adding that infrastructure like access to mall and parking place too play an important role.

Lifestyle International Managing Director Kabir Lumba said that affordability of retail space is also key factor along with location, size and tenant-mix. "Enough space is available, not lot of quality space."

Realty firm Ambience Group Chairman Raj Singh Gehlot welcomed the FDI in multi-brand retail, but said the country needs to have space for retail.

However, he said that most of the developers are not interested in developing mall.

Sanka of DLF said that everyone is excited with FDI in retail, but said large amount of balance needs to be created.
